Muhyiddin Wants Priority Given To Environmental Conservation. October 05, 2009 11:33 AM

PUTRAJAYA, Oct 5 (Bernama) — Environmental conservation and preservation must be given priority not only in terms of policy and programmes but also in the efforts implemented, Tan Sri Muhyiddin Yassin said Monday.
The deputy prime minister said although Malaysia had an action plan for this, the levelling of hills and mountains and pollution of rivers and lakes still occurred because of the irresponsible attitude of some parties.
“Malaysia is said to be one of the 10 top nations rich in biodiversity, with such high value, and special attention should be given to ensure that the environment is constantly protected and preserved,” he said at the monthly gathering of the Prime Minister’s Department (JPM) here.
He said the JPM was the most important department involved directly and indirectly in ensuring that conservation and preservation of this biodiversity was carried out and in raising the awareness of the society and those responsible of the importance of protecting the country’s treasure.
Putrajaya, he said, could serve as a model after attracting tourists by the droves with its beauty not only in terms of its infrastructure but also its environment, especially the clean and unpolluted lakes.
Muhyiddin said not only must beauty and environment be maintained, it must be upgraded, especially parking facilities, which cause traffic jams that should not occur in Putrajaya.
“Environment is a serious issue and world leaders are expected to discuss serious issues like climate change because people nowadays are less concerned about preserving the environment, not only in Malaysia but throughout the world,” he said.
He added the civil servants can set an example by becoming role models for the future generation through the preservation of Fiona and flora.
“We must safeguard the serenity and cleanliness of the environment, reduce green house gas, reduce pollution, conserve energy, especially in government buildings, and that can help reduce the expenditure of the government,” he said.
The issue of collection and disposal of rubbish and solid waste effectively has yet to be resolved and many are still not aware of the importance and value of keeping their places clean.
Muhyiddin said the recent earth-quake in Padang, Indonesia is also a reminder of how important it is to preserve and conserve the environment and how fortunate Malaysians are for not living in fear of earth-quakes because Malaysia is not situated in the ‘Ring of Fire’ (the Pacific Islands arcs where most of the world’s volcanic action is involved).
